无法将背景图片从资产设置为容器

时间:2019-10-01 20:01:42

标签: flutter

我面临以下问题:我想添加图像作为容器的背景。为此,我在项目的根目录中创建了一个文件夹images。在这里,我添加了background.png。我也将这样的行添加到pubspec.yaml

flutter:
  assets:
    - images/

将以下行添加到屏幕的班级之后:

Container(
        decoration: BoxDecoration(
          image: DecorationImage(image: AssetImage("images/backround.png")),
        )),

但是当我运行该应用程序时,出现以下异常:

I/flutter ( 4072): The following assertion was thrown resolving an image codec:
I/flutter ( 4072): Unable to load asset: images/backround.png

所以,我不明白这是什么问题。预先感谢您的帮助!

1 个答案:

答案 0 :(得分:1)

根据您的问题,您有错字,请更改

backround.png

background.png